ServerSocket library

The ServerSocket library provides an implementation of a server socket in C#. It allows accepting client connections, receiving and sending data, and handling connection and disconnection events.

Usage

The following is an example of how to use the ServerSocket library to accept client connections:

var serverSocket = new ServerSocket(PortListening: 4567, SocketBufferSize: 1024)
{
    ServerIP = "127.0.0.1",
    EncodingType= DataEncodingType.ASCII
};
serverSocket.ConnectedClient += (client) => Console.WriteLine($"Client connected: {client}");
serverSocket.DisconnectedClient += (client) => Console.WriteLine($"Client disconnected: {client}");
serverSocket.DataReceived += (data, clientId) => Console.WriteLine($"Data received: {data} from client: {clientId}");
await serverSocket.Listen(new CancellationToken());
